BLOCKED CURING AGENT [1 record]

Record 1 2014-04-11

English

Subject field(s)
  • Glues and Adhesives (Industries)
DEF

A curing or hardening agent temporarily rendered unreactive, which can be reactivated as desired by physical or chemical means.

OBS

blocked curing agent: term and definition standardized by ISO [International Organization for Standardization].
